Subject: Re: [RESEND PATCH] arm64: fix alternatives with LLVM's integrated assembler
Date: Thu, 31 Oct 2019 13:03:02 -0700	[thread overview]
Message-ID: <201910311303.2FBAA3E3@keescook> (raw)
In-Reply-To: <20191031194652.118427-1-samitolvanen@google.com>

On Thu, Oct 31, 2019 at 12:46:52PM -0700, Sami Tolvanen wrote:
> LLVM's integrated assembler fails with the following error when
> building KVM:
> 
>   <inline asm>:12:6: error: expected absolute expression
>    .if kvm_update_va_mask == 0
>        ^
>   <inline asm>:21:6: error: expected absolute expression
>    .if kvm_update_va_mask == 0
>        ^
>   <inline asm>:24:2: error: unrecognized instruction mnemonic
>           NOT_AN_INSTRUCTION
>           ^
>   LLVM ERROR: Error parsing inline asm
> 
> These errors come from ALTERNATIVE_CB and __ALTERNATIVE_CFG,
> which test for the existence of the callback parameter in inline
> assembly using the following expression:
> 
>   " .if " __stringify(cb) " == 0\n"
> 
> This works with GNU as, but isn't supported by LLVM. This change
> splits __ALTERNATIVE_CFG and ALTINSTR_ENTRY into separate macros
> to fix the LLVM build.
> 
> Link: https://github.com/ClangBuiltLinux/linux/issues/472
> Signed-off-by: Sami Tolvanen <samitolvanen@google.com>

> ---
>  arch/arm64/include/asm/alternative.h | 32 ++++++++++++++++++----------
>  1 file changed, 21 insertions(+), 11 deletions(-)
> 
> diff --git a/arch/arm64/include/asm/alternative.h b/arch/arm64/include/asm/alternative.h
> index b9f8d787eea9..324e7d5ab37e 100644
> --- a/arch/arm64/include/asm/alternative.h
> +++ b/arch/arm64/include/asm/alternative.h
> @@ -35,13 +35,16 @@ void apply_alternatives_module(void *start, size_t length);
>  static inline void apply_alternatives_module(void *start, size_t length) { }
>  #endif
>  
> -#define ALTINSTR_ENTRY(feature,cb)					      \
> +#define ALTINSTR_ENTRY(feature)					              \
>  	" .word 661b - .\n"				/* label           */ \
> -	" .if " __stringify(cb) " == 0\n"				      \
>  	" .word 663f - .\n"				/* new instruction */ \
> -	" .else\n"							      \
> +	" .hword " __stringify(feature) "\n"		/* feature bit     */ \
> +	" .byte 662b-661b\n"				/* source len      */ \
> +	" .byte 664f-663f\n"				/* replacement len */
> +
> +#define ALTINSTR_ENTRY_CB(feature, cb)					      \
> +	" .word 661b - .\n"				/* label           */ \
>  	" .word " __stringify(cb) "- .\n"		/* callback */	      \
> -	" .endif\n"							      \
>  	" .hword " __stringify(feature) "\n"		/* feature bit     */ \
>  	" .byte 662b-661b\n"				/* source len      */ \
>  	" .byte 664f-663f\n"				/* replacement len */
> @@ -62,15 +65,14 @@ static inline void apply_alternatives_module(void *start, size_t length) { }
>   *
>   * Alternatives with callbacks do not generate replacement instructions.
>   */
> -#define __ALTERNATIVE_CFG(oldinstr, newinstr, feature, cfg_enabled, cb)	\
> +#define __ALTERNATIVE_CFG(oldinstr, newinstr, feature, cfg_enabled)	\
>  	".if "__stringify(cfg_enabled)" == 1\n"				\
>  	"661:\n\t"							\
>  	oldinstr "\n"							\
>  	"662:\n"							\
>  	".pushsection .altinstructions,\"a\"\n"				\
> -	ALTINSTR_ENTRY(feature,cb)					\
> +	ALTINSTR_ENTRY(feature)						\
>  	".popsection\n"							\
> -	" .if " __stringify(cb) " == 0\n"				\
>  	".pushsection .altinstr_replacement, \"a\"\n"			\
>  	"663:\n\t"							\
>  	newinstr "\n"							\
> @@ -78,17 +80,25 @@ static inline void apply_alternatives_module(void *start, size_t length) { }
>  	".popsection\n\t"						\
>  	".org	. - (664b-663b) + (662b-661b)\n\t"			\
>  	".org	. - (662b-661b) + (664b-663b)\n"			\
> -	".else\n\t"							\
> +	".endif\n"
> +
> +#define __ALTERNATIVE_CFG_CB(oldinstr, feature, cfg_enabled, cb)	\
> +	".if "__stringify(cfg_enabled)" == 1\n"				\
> +	"661:\n\t"							\
> +	oldinstr "\n"							\
> +	"662:\n"							\
> +	".pushsection .altinstructions,\"a\"\n"				\
> +	ALTINSTR_ENTRY_CB(feature, cb)					\
> +	".popsection\n"							\
>  	"663:\n\t"							\
>  	"664:\n\t"							\
> -	".endif\n"							\
>  	".endif\n"
>  
>  #define _ALTERNATIVE_CFG(oldinstr, newinstr, feature, cfg, ...)	\
> -	__ALTERNATIVE_CFG(oldinstr, newinstr, feature, IS_ENABLED(cfg), 0)
> +	__ALTERNATIVE_CFG(oldinstr, newinstr, feature, IS_ENABLED(cfg))
>  
>  #define ALTERNATIVE_CB(oldinstr, cb) \
> -	__ALTERNATIVE_CFG(oldinstr, "NOT_AN_INSTRUCTION", ARM64_CB_PATCH, 1, cb)
> +	__ALTERNATIVE_CFG_CB(oldinstr, ARM64_CB_PATCH, 1, cb)
>  #else
>  
>  #include <asm/assembler.h>
